McCLENDON v. WALL

No. 4474.

96 So.2d 246 (1957)

Dr. J. H. McCLENDON, Sr., Defendant-Appellee, v. Barney Tate WALL, Plaintiff-Appellant.

Court of Appeal of Louisiana, First Circuit.

June 28, 1957.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Reid & Reid, Hammond, for appellant.

Mary Purser, L. B. Ponder, Jr., Amite, for appellee.


TATE, Judge.

This suit arises under the provisions of LSA-R.S. 41:541 et seq., providing for the homesteading by citizens of this State of unredeemed lands adjudicated to the State for unpaid taxes. Appellant Wall appeals from judgment below annulling his homestead entry to a certain forty-acre quarter—quarter-section of land situated in Tangipahoa Parish.
